Ryan’s Fancy CDs
Nobody could have been as excited as l when l saw in the Downhomer a special release of 42 songs from Ryan's Fancy. I was on the phone to order those immediately. While l knew l would love all the songs picked, l especially hoped one favourite song would have made the cut.
When l first married a Newfoundlander and came to Central Newfoundland, l fell in love with the Irish and English tunes. Never having heard any of this music in northern Ontario, l had no idea how much it would appeal to me. Then Ryan's Fancy got their own television series and l would watch them every week. We owned several of their eight-track tapes and played them in our van as we drove around town or went with the kids out to the bay. The music would play and our oldest girl Monica would sing along with the songs. On a visit to Ontario to see my parents, Monica would sing her favourite song from their collection for her grandmother. Mom loved to hear her sing.
I think it was 1979 when Ryan's Fancy came to Grand Falls to perform. I took Monica and it was such a thrill for us to sit through a show and meet them in the lobby after. Monica even gave Dermot O'Reilly a kiss on the cheek.
Years later Monica asked me to look for tapes of their music and if l found any, to buy the one with our favourite song on it. I found one tape in Toronto at Sam the Record Man, but alas the song was not there. After that l forgot about it and believed l would never hear their music again. So imagine my surprise when l read the Downhomer and there was the CD offered for purchase. As soon as it arrived l tore open the package and scanned the contents. There it was, number 12, "Coal Town Road."
